🦠 YOUR KIDNEYS HAVE A GUT FEELING.

Okay… maybe your kidneys don't literally have feelings. 😉 But the gut–kidney connection is becoming an increasingly interesting area of research. Your digestive tract is home to trillions of microorganisms. What you eat can influence those microbes—and the substances they produce.

One area researchers are especially interested in is dietary fiber. Certain fibers are fermented by gut microbes, producing compounds such as short-chain fatty acids (SCFAs). Researchers are investigating how these microbial metabolites may interact with inflammation, metabolism, the intestinal barrier and kidney health.

And there's another fascinating piece: CKD can affect the gut microbiome, too. That means the relationship isn't simply: food → gut → kidneys. It's much more interconnected than that. Recent research is looking closely at how changes in the gut microbiome may influence gut-derived metabolites in people with CKD.

Here's the important part: This does NOT mean everyone with CKD should simply "eat more fiber." Kidney nutrition is personal. Your CKD stage, lab values, medications and individual potassium, phosphorus, protein and fluid needs all matter.

So rather than chasing the latest "kidney superfood," we're interested in something bigger, and that's understanding how the pieces fit together because your kidneys don't exist in isolation.

Your kidneys may be small, but their impact is anything but. Many people think chronic kidney disease only affects the kidneys. The truth? Your kidneys are part of an incredible team that works around the clock to help keep your entire body in balance.

Healthy kidneys play an important role in:

❤️ Supporting heart health and healthy blood pressure
🦴 Helping maintain strong bones through vitamin D activation and mineral balance
🩸 Producing signals that help your body make red blood cells
⚡ Supporting healthy nerve and muscle function by helping regulate electrolytes
💧 Managing fluid balance throughout the body

When kidney function changes, other parts of the body can be affected too—which is why taking a whole-body approach to your health matters.

Ever feel overwhelmed trying to grocery shop after a CKD diagnosis? You're not alone.

One of the most common questions we hear is: "What should I buy?"

The truth is, there isn't one universal "kidney diet." What belongs in your cart depends on your stage of CKD, lab values, medications, and the guidance of your nephrologist or renal dietitian.

That said, there are a few habits that can help almost anyone become a more confident shopper:

🛒 Fill your cart with plenty of whole, minimally processed foods when possible.

🧂 Check the sodium before anything else on packaged foods.

📖 Read the ingredient list—not just the front of the package. Marketing terms like "natural" or "healthy" don't always tell the whole story.

🔍 Compare brands. Two similar products can have very different amounts of sodium or added ingredients.

🥗 Remember that no single food makes or breaks your kidney health. Consistent, informed choices over time often matter more than striving for perfection.

Reading food labels can feel like learning a new language after a CKD diagnosis—but it doesn't have to. One of the most empowering skills you can develop is knowing what to look for before a product goes into your cart.

A few extra seconds reading the Nutrition Facts panel and ingredient list can help you make choices that better align with your health goals. And remember, there isn't one "perfect" food for everyone with disease. Your stage of , lab values, medications, and guidance from your or all matter.

✨ Start simple:
✔️ Check the serving size.
✔️ Look at the sodium.
✔️ Read the ingredients.
✔️ Compare brands instead of assuming they're all the same.

Over time, these small habits become second nature.
